In the framework of the exhibition Ensayos sobre lo cutre. Lecturas del archivo Miguel Benlloch (Essays on seediness. Readings from the Miguel Benlloch archive) exhibition and the programming around the Day of Dance, IVAM presents the performance Negro (Negro Live set) y Rossa (RSRJ RJRS) by María Salgado and Fran MM Cabeza de Vaca.

Both pieces explore moments of subjective and collective disobedience, not through speech, but through aesthetic materiality of some audios and some texts. Negro (Negro Live set) talks about desire as a driving force from poems with luxurious language, snippets of a political manifesto with the form of a poem, putting videoclips into words and extreme lyrical loops; while Rossa (RSRJ RJRS) akes binary classifications of gender and identity to the extreme to dissolve them and rave about them using a combinatorial analysis (Gertrude Stein and Steve Reich).
